Griffin is a scholar working on Endocrinology, Diabetes and Metabolism, Surgery and Pulmonary and Respiratory Medicine. According to data from OpenAlex, Griffin has authored 20 papers receiving a total of 306 indexed citations (citations by other indexed papers that have themselves been cited), including 4 papers in Endocrinology, Diabetes and Metabolism, 3 papers in Surgery and 3 papers in Pulmonary and Respiratory Medicine. Recurrent topics in Griffin's work include Automotive and Human Injury Biomechanics (2 papers), Glaucoma and retinal disorders (2 papers) and Diabetes Management and Research (2 papers). Griffin is often cited by papers focused on Automotive and Human Injury Biomechanics (2 papers), Glaucoma and retinal disorders (2 papers) and Diabetes Management and Research (2 papers). Griffin collaborates with scholars based in United Kingdom, United States and Greece. Griffin's co-authors include Wang, Watson, Freeman, �. Tan, Russell-Jones, Tamilla Curtis, George S. Sfyroeras, Stephanie M. Dillon, Steve Bain and Hart and has published in prestigious journals such as The Lancet, The American Naturalist and British Journal of Dermatology.
